The y-intercept of a function is the point where the graph of the function intersects the y-axis. This happens when x = 0.

So, to find the y-coordinate of the y-intercept of the function f(x) = 2(x^2 - 2)(x + 5)(x^2 - 1)^3, we substitute x = 0 into the function:

f(0) = 2(0^2 - 2)(0 + 5)(0^2 - 1)^3 = 2(-2)(5)(-1)^3 = 2*(-2)5(-1) = 20

So, the y-coordinate of the y-intercept of the function is 20.
